Facebook pixel
>Blog>Ciência de Dados
Ciência de Dados

Aprenda a Desenvolver com o Poderoso Framework Python

Aprenda a Desenvolver com o Poderoso Framework Python e leve suas habilidades de programação para o próximo nível! Descubra os recursos avançados do Framework Python, como Django, Flask, NumPy e Pandas.

Introdução ao Poderoso Framework Python

O Python é uma linguagem de programação poderosa e versátil que tem sido amplamente utilizada por desenvolvedores em todo o mundo. Com sua sintaxe simples e clara, juntamente com uma ampla gama de bibliotecas e frameworks disponíveis, o Python se tornou uma escolha popular para projetos de desenvolvimento de software. Neste artigo, vamos explorar o poderoso Framework Python e como você pode começar a desenvolver com ele.

Aprenda os Conceitos Básicos de Desenvolvimento com Python

Antes de mergulharmos no Framework Python, é importante ter uma compreensão dos conceitos básicos de desenvolvimento com Python. Python é conhecido por sua legibilidade e facilidade de uso, tornando-o uma ótima opção para iniciantes. Aqui estão alguns conceitos importantes que você precisa conhecer:

1. Variáveis e Tipos de Dados:

Em Python, você pode atribuir valores a variáveis e usar diferentes tipos de dados, como números, strings e listas. Isso permite que você armazene e manipule informações em seu programa.

2. Estruturas de Controle:

Python oferece estruturas de controle, como loops e condicionais, que permitem controlar o fluxo de execução do programa. Isso é útil para repetir ações ou tomar decisões com base em determinadas condições.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

3. Funções:

As funções em Python permitem que você agrupe um conjunto de instruções em um bloco reutilizável de código. Isso promove a modularidade e facilita a manutenção do seu código.

4. Bibliotecas:

Python possui uma vasta biblioteca padrão que oferece uma ampla gama de funcionalidades prontas para uso. Essas bibliotecas abrangem desde manipulação de arquivos e acesso a bancos de dados até criação de interfaces gráficas e processamento de imagens.

Explorando os Recursos Avançados do Framework Python

Agora que você tem uma base sólida em Python, é hora de explorar os recursos avançados do Framework Python. O Framework Python é uma coleção de bibliotecas e módulos que fornecem funcionalidades específicas para facilitar o desenvolvimento de aplicativos. Aqui estão alguns recursos avançados que você pode aproveitar:

Django:

O Django é um dos frameworks Python mais populares para desenvolvimento web. Ele oferece recursos poderosos, como um ORM (Object-Relational Mapping) integrado, que facilita a interação com bancos de dados, e um sistema de administração pronto para uso.

Flask:

O Flask é um framework leve que é amplamente utilizado para o desenvolvimento de aplicativos web simples e rápidos. Ele oferece uma abordagem minimalista, permitindo que você escolha as bibliotecas e ferramentas que deseja usar, em vez de impor uma estrutura rígida.

NumPy:

NumPy é uma biblioteca poderosa para computação científica em Python. Ele fornece suporte para arrays multidimensionais e funções matemáticas de alto desempenho, tornando-o ideal para análise de dados e cálculos científicos.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

Pandas:

O Pandas é uma biblioteca de análise de dados que fornece estruturas de dados flexíveis e eficientes para manipulação e análise de dados. Com o Pandas, você pode facilmente importar, limpar e transformar dados, além de realizar operações complexas de análise e visualização.

Dicas e Melhores Práticas para Desenvolver com o Framework Python

Agora que você tem uma compreensão básica do Framework Python e seus recursos avançados, aqui estão algumas dicas e melhores práticas para ajudá-lo a desenvolver com eficiência:

  • Organize seu código: Mantenha seu código limpo e bem organizado seguindo as convenções de estilo do Python, como o PEP 8. Use espaços em branco e indentação apropriados para melhorar a legibilidade do seu código.
  • Documente seu código: É importante adicionar comentários e documentação ao seu código para torná-lo mais compreensível para outros desenvolvedores e para você mesmo no futuro.
  • Teste seu código: Escreva testes unitários para garantir que seu código esteja funcionando corretamente. Isso ajuda a identificar e corrigir problemas mais cedo, economizando tempo e esforço no longo prazo.
  • Utilize boas práticas de segurança: Proteja seu aplicativo contra vulnerabilidades de segurança, como injeção de código SQL e ataques de cross-site scripting. Valide e sanitize sempre os dados de entrada e utilize recursos de autenticação e autorização adequados.
  • Mantenha-se atualizado: O mundo da programação está em constante evolução. Mantenha-se atualizado com as últimas atualizações e versões do Python e do Framework Python para aproveitar os recursos mais recentes e corrigir possíveis problemas de segurança.

Conclusão

O Framework Python é uma ferramenta poderosa para o desenvolvimento de aplicativos, oferecendo uma ampla gama de recursos e bibliotecas. Ao aprender os conceitos básicos de desenvolvimento com Python e explorar os recursos avançados do Framework Python, você estará bem equipado para desenvolver aplicativos eficientes e de alta qualidade. Lembre-se de seguir as melhores práticas e continuar aprendendo para aprimorar suas habilidades de desenvolvimento com o Poderoso Framework Python. Aprenda a Desenvolver com o Poderoso Framework Python e leve suas habilidades de programação para o próximo nível!

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ada

Aprenda uma nova língua na maior escola de idioma do mundo!

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a.

+ 400 mil alunos

Método validado

Aulas

Ao vivo e gravadas

+ 1000 horas

Duração dos cursos

Certificados

Reconhecido pelo mercado

Quero estudar na Fluency

Sobre o autor

A melhor plataforma para aprender tecnologia no Brasil

A Awari é a melhor maneira de aprender tecnologia no Brasil.
Faça parte e tenha acesso a cursos com aulas ao vivo e mentorias individuais com os melhores profissionais do mercado.